文章出處

本來沒有想著弄PHP,但是有同學叫我幫忙啟動一下一個PHP寫的后臺。著實需要去學習一下。

想著安裝xampp軟件,一個集合了多個服務器,多個數據庫,多個后臺語言的管理軟件。

一、xampp下載

二、安裝

三、配置

四、運行項目

 

一、xampp下載

地址1:官方網站   https://www.apachefriends.org/zh_cn/download.html

地址2: 百度云盤  鏈接:http://pan.baidu.com/s/1dFzQ5S9 密碼:emp9

 

二、安裝

雙擊應用程序

一路next

一直next就可以了

選擇安裝路徑

 開始安裝

 

 三、配置

啟動xampp軟件,啟動apache和mysql兩個start按鈕,如果都變成stop或者下邊沒有彈出紅色字體報錯,恭喜你,安裝太順利了!

啟動apache服務器,出現報錯,如下圖所示

但是,對于大多數人而言,因為曾經安裝過SQLSERVER 或者MySQL 或者IIS或者Apache等軟件,導致端口的復用。因此在錯誤窗口常看到report的字樣~~~這時候,需要修改端口。

Apache的端口默認為80,MySQL的端口默認為3306,同時需要注意,Apache配置的時候還需要配置一下SSL的端口,其默認端口443.

可以將Apache、MySQL、SSL的端口依次更改為:81,3366,4433.下面詳細介紹配置的文件吧。

 

1、我們先配置APACHE和SSL。

在這張圖片上很清晰地看到,Apache的后面有一個Config的按鈕,點擊選擇下面的第一個文件:Apache(httpd.conf),這個文件就是配置Apache的端口的文件,該文件在安裝路徑下可以找到,如筆者的在這兒:D:\software\programingsoftware\xampp\apache\conf\httpd.conf。

打開該文件(httpd.conf),看到有80就改為81,總共有2-3處,修改后保存。我們接下來在修改SSL,打開apache(httpd-ssl.conf)的文件,將443全部改為4433,總共3-4處,修改后保存。然后啟動apache。哈哈,看到了吧,可以啟動了。詳細的參數看圖片吧。就知道說是否在運行。

 

檢驗apache是否成功,在瀏覽器中輸入localhost,可以看到,如下圖所示,說明安裝成功。

 

 

  2、配置MySQL的環境。

點擊MySQL后面的Config按鈕,選擇my.ini文件,筆者的文件在D:\software\programingsoftware\xampp\mysql\bin\my.ini,打開修改里面的額端口,將3306端口修改為3366.(提醒:如果你的MySQL可以啟動,請勿再配置,也就不需要往下看。)總共5處。修改后保存,嘗試啟動。如果啟動成功,恭喜你配置到此結束。

3、正常啟動之后

 

四、運行項目

 

打開本機服務器文件夾d:/XAMPP/htdocs 創建三個項目所需的HTML文件,數據庫sql文件,php文件,名字建議用英文,因為htdocs文件夾下起中文名字不利于外界訪問,可能出現亂碼的現象。
 
我把之前htdocs里的文件都刪了,新建自己的項目(或者復制把項目復制到這里)

注意:

1、那我們自己寫的文件該放在哪里才能運行呢?答案是在xampp\htdocs目錄下,如果存在index.php文件,優先執行該文件,如果不存在,則訪問localhost將顯示網站目錄。

2、當前該服務器是可以直接執行PHP類型的文件的。我們在該xampp\htdoc目錄下新建a.php文件,輸入代碼<?php  echo ‘Hello BaiDu!’; ?>,打開瀏覽器訪問localhost/a.php。

 

現在在運行項目,在瀏覽器中輸入localhost/index.html。就可以看到效果。

 


文章列表




Avast logo

Avast 防毒軟體已檢查此封電子郵件的病毒。
www.avast.com


arrow
arrow
    全站熱搜
    創作者介紹
    創作者 大師兄 的頭像
    大師兄

    IT工程師數位筆記本

    大師兄 發表在 痞客邦 留言(0) 人氣()